SUBJECT: PEPSICO REINSTATES MOUNTAIN DEW “WHITE OUT” FOLLOWING UNPRECEDENTED CONSUMER CAMPAIGN
WHAT: In a move that has sent shockwaves through the beverage and marketing industries, PepsiCo has officially announced the limited-time return of Mountain Dew “White Out,” a citrus-flavored, translucent beverage that had been discontinued from permanent retail shelves in 2019. The product is scheduled for a nationwide rollout beginning July 15th.
WHO: The decision was made by PepsiCo’s Senior Leadership Team following what the company describes as an “unprecedented, organic consumer mobilization.” The campaign was spearheaded by the online fan group “Dew Drinkers United,” which amassed a petition of over 250,000 signatures and generated more than 15 million social media impressions using the hashtag #BringBackWhiteOut.
WHEN: The product was originally launched in 2010 as the winner of the “Dewmocracy” consumer-vote campaign. It was phased out of the company’s core portfolio five years prior to this announcement. The limited-edition re-release will be available for a six-week window, from July 15th through August 31st.
WHERE: The beverage will be available at all major national retailers, including Walmart, Target, Kroger, and convenience store chains. Distribution will be limited to the continental United States.
WHY: PepsiCo officials cited “an overwhelming, sustained demand from the consumer base” as the primary catalyst for the product’s revival. A spokesperson for the company confirmed that internal metrics indicated White Out retained a “cult-like following” and that the volume of digital engagement over the last eighteen months made a re-release “a clear strategic imperative.”
